>The code in OpenBSD-current for getprotobyname_r, getprotobynumber_r
>and getservbyport_r is what will appear in 3.7. We don't currently
>have a gethostbyname_r and I doubt we will by 3.7 since making the
>resolver re-entrant is a non-trivial task.
The glibc people made their resolver reentrant by using thread-local
storage for all resolver-related variables. So the global 'res' state
variable (resolv.h) is actually #defined to call a function that returns
the thread-local version.
But that begs the question: if their resolver is non-reentrant, do they
have getaddrinfo (which is mandatorily thread-safe)?
